Jason Boys is the new Director of Online Graduate Programs at the School of Labor and Employment Relations. In this role, he oversees recruitment, enrollment pipelines, student services, and strategic partnerships for the School’s online MHRIR and certificate programs.

He brings over a decade of experience in higher education, workforce development, and employer engagement. Most recently, he served as Senior Partnership Operations Specialist at Herzing University, where he managed enrollment and student services for more than 300 students annually across multiple online and hybrid programs, while also leading custom workforce training initiatives in collaboration with healthcare providers, school districts, and community organizations.

Previously, he was Director of Workforce Education at St. Petersburg College in Florida, where he developed and launched more than a dozen new industry certification programs in healthcare, IT, and skilled trades — including securing grant and partnership funding to establish a new electrical lineworker training center.

Jason is no stranger to LER, having earlier served as Associate Director of Career and Student Services. In that role, he supported the on-campus MHRIR program across an array of career services, student recruitment, and employer engagement functions.

He holds an M.A. in Communication from the University of New Mexico and a B.A. in Communication from the University of Cincinnati.
